Read on Google MapsI had an amazing experience from start to finish. I started with the chicken lollipop and Chettinadu chicken soup both were incredibly flavorful and hit the spot. The dipped vada with sambar was also good, though I wish it was a bit more soaked to really soak up all the flavors. For the main course, the Mysore masala dosa stood out as the best it was fully coated with spicy masala and perfectly balanced, not sweet at all. The chicken kothu parotta was absolutely delicious, packed with bold spices and textures. I also tried the classic parotta with a side of chicken Chettinadu curry, and it did not disappoint. Every bite was rich and satisfying. To wrap up the meal, I had buttermilk, which came with refreshing ginger bits in every sip, and a glass of rose milk that instantly took me back to my childhood days. Every dish I tried was full of flavor and definitely a place I’d love to visit again!
Read on Google MapsNot bad, but definitely far from great. It has 2 big positives going for it though in that it's open a bit later than other places plus all the dishes are marked with their allergens next to them. An awkward amount of their dishes that in other restaurants would be dairy-free, appear to contain dairy at this place though. Which is sorely disappointing. If they could find a way to change this so that their lentil or vegetable curries could be safe for vegans, that would definitely bump them up to four stars.
